Max breaks down on his way to the grid

Formula 1 celebrated 50 years of the Canadian Grand Prix on Sunday with Sebastian Vettel having the most to cheer about as he claimed the victory, despite having to pick up a rather sullen passenger. Lewis Hamilton had a meet and greet with Formula 1's new supremo, Chase Carey, who along with his mustache was on hand to mark Canada's 50th GP. Fernando Alonso Sebastian Vettel was all smiles on the parade lap as the championship leader waved to the fans. That, though, changed when he picked up a passenger. Max Verstappen's parade car broke down and he thumbed a lift with Vettel. Neither seemed terribly impressed.
